background image

 

Haptic Devices Documentation 

Page 1 on 34 

 
 

 

 
 
 

Haptic Documentation 

 

ENGLISH 

2

 

FRANÇAIS 

18

 

 
 

Summary of Contents for ForceTube

Page 1: ...Haptic Devices Documentation Page 1 on 34 Haptic Documentation ENGLISH 2 FRANÇAIS 18 ...

Page 2: ...INTEGRATION IN GAMES 8 4 2 BACKWARD COMPATIBILITY WITH STEAMVR 9 5 COMPANION APPLICATION FOR WINDOWS 10 5 1 CHANNEL BINDING 10 5 2 STEAMVR BACKWARD COMPATIBILITY 11 5 3 NATIVE GAME CUSTOMIZATION 13 5 4 DEMO 14 5 5 KNUCKLES FIX 15 6 OTHER FEATURES 16 6 1 FORCETUBE AUTO RESEARCH 16 6 2 TARGETED CHANNEL COMBO BOX 16 6 3 DISPLAY FORCETUBE RENDERER 16 6 4 PRESETS SECTION 16 6 5 UPDATER VIA WI FI 17 ...

Page 3: ...w As the ForceTube is the original product all the haptic devices are called ForceTube on the Bluetooth pairing and on the Companion app 1 HAPTIC DEVICES Be sure to know what model you have before doing any software update The device will not work if you do it wrong refer to the This won t be taken under warranty Charging slot Power button Power button Charging slot Power button Power button Charg...

Page 4: ...e and is steady when connected You can charge the module with the provided USB C to USB charging cable Plug the USB C connector into the module s USB port below the power button on the front and then plug the USB connector into a USB port on your computer Important trying to use a USB C to USB C or an electrical outlet instead of your PC can result in the module not receiving any charge You should...

Page 5: ... and make sure it is not connected to another computer phone Oculus Quest before the batteries level LED should blink 1 Open the Windows settings 2 Click Devices 3 Click Bluetooth and other devices 4 Turn on the Bluetooth if it isn t done 5 Click Add Bluetooth or other device 6 Click Bluetooth 7 as mentioned above all the haptic device are called ForceTube on the Bluetooth pairing and on the Compa...

Page 6: ...d Windows had difficulties recognizing it assuming it is a new Bluetooth dongle even if it isn t So you should try to remove the ForceTube from your Bluetooth devices to pair it again If you have difficulties to remove it 1 Go to your Device Manager 2 Click on View 3 Click on Show Hidden Devices 4 Open the Bluetooth tab 5 In this Bluetooth tab uninstall all unconnected devices they have lighter ic...

Page 7: ...blem is on your computer the first thing to check is the Bluetooth dongle If you were using one you already had try uninstalling it and using the provided one If you were using the provided dongle try uninstalling it restart your computer and reinstalling it on different USB ports o If after trying various USB ports it still does not work then the issue is likely the Bluetooth dongle Contact our S...

Page 8: ...C Oculus Quest 1 2 o on SteamVR Go to your SteamVR library Right click on Onward Select Properties In General tab click Set launch options Write forcetube without the Restart the game if it was launched The FORCETUBEVR option must be set to ENABLED in the main menu settings o On Oculus Quest 1 2 Follow step 3 2 Once done go on the Onward game s settings Then on the Haptics settings And Enable the ...

Page 9: ...tent 2 Select ForceTubeVR Companion 3 Select ForceTubeVR Companion Application rar 4 Select Download to download the rar file To update the dll 1 Go to the game s local files 2 Find the ForceTube dll file It will be named something like ForceTubeVR_API_x32 dll or ForceTubeVR_API_x64 dll 3 Add old to the name of the existing one 4 Copy the new dll from the previously downloaded rar file and paste i...

Page 10: ...s that have more than one Haptic device are hidden if Show advanced settings is off In this situation all the settings visible and the output you can trigger in the Demo tab indifferently target all the devices channels If Show advanced settings is on the Channels binding tab the Knuckles fix tab and the Targeted channel combo box in the bottom of the user interface are visible and all the setting...

Page 11: ...ombo box at the bottom to match with the column where you clicked You can also see a Save channels order button at the bottom of this tab It saves the module you forced in channels If you quit and restart the application it will be kept as you saved it 5 2 STEAMVR BACKWARD COMPATIBILITY You can use it to re use the rumble requests sent by SteamVR to your VR controllers and transmit them to your ha...

Page 12: ...ce the kick power because directly linked to the motor activation duration The Minimum rumble duration slider lets you choose the minimum duration of a rumble performed by the module All shorter rumble duration requests will be bringing to this value This feature is hidden if Show advanced settings is off The point of this function is to drive the rumble motors long enough to be felt by the player...

Page 13: ...nnel You can see it in the Channel combo box on the bottom To edit another channel select it in this combo box before The Native kick power multiplier slider lets you choose to increase or reduce the kick powers of module requests from the natively compatible games The Native rumble power multiplier slider lets you choose to increase or reduce the rumble powers of module requests from the natively...

Page 14: ...ch sends powerful shots with a low frequency while enabled The Example lasergun button triggers an increasing rumble when it is clicked the first time simulating a power loading laser gun and sends a powerful shot with a rumbling power relative to the loading duration when it is clicked the second time The Custom single shot button sends a request containing a kick if the Enable kick button is ena...

Page 15: ...n find it in the Valve Index Knuckles driver folder directly in the Companion Application directory Open it close SteamVR and execute InstallDriver exe The Knuckle fix tab in your Companion Application is now functional Once done the Enable knuckles to fix button lets you enable or disable the following fix When enabled The knuckles accelerations in SteamVR will be limited to the Accelero max valu...

Page 16: ...d by requests from the Demo tab You can change it by clicking and selecting the new one you want to edit or target When you select a new channel you should see the SteamVR Backward Compatibility and Native Game Personalization values change to the ones of the newly selected channel 6 3 DISPLAY HAPTIC DEVICE RENDERER The Display ForceTubeVR renderer button opens a transparent window containing a Ha...

Page 17: ...rsion s number entered is the same as the one already uploaded on the haptic device the app reports it and cancels the update o If the device cannot connect to the Wi Fi network for 10 seconds it sends a signal back to the app and you can retry updating If the device manages to connect to the Wi Fi network a tab opens in the web browser that returns an upload form Choose the latest bin file compat...

Page 18: ... 24 4 1 INTEGRATION NATIVE EN JEU 24 4 2 RETROCOMPATIBILITE POUR STEAMVR 26 5 COMPANION APPLICATION POUR WINDOWS 27 5 1 LIAISON DES CANAUX 27 5 2 RETROCOMPATIBILITE POUR STEAMVR 28 5 3 PERSONNALISATION DES JEUX NATIVEMENT COMPATIBLES 30 5 4 DEMO 31 5 5 KNUCKLES FIX 32 6 AUTRES FONCTIONS 33 6 1 RECHERCHE AUTOMATIQUE DU PERIPHERIQUE 33 6 2 LISTE DEROULANTE DES CHANNELS CIBLES 33 6 3 AFFICHER LE REND...

Page 19: ...les modules haptiques sont appelés ForceTube lors du couplage Bluetooth et dans l application Companion 1 LES DIFFERENTS PERIPHERIQUES HAPTIQUES Assure toi de savoir quel périphérique haptique tu possèdes avant de faire une mise à jour du logiciel L appareil ne fonctionnera plus si tu le fais Cela ne sera pas pris sous la garantie Port de charge Bouton de marche arrêt Port de charge Bouton de marc...

Page 20: ...dre lorsque qu il n est pas appairé à un PC Quest téléphone et est stable une fois connecté Tu peux charger le module haptique avec le câble USB C to USB fourni Branche la partie USB C sur le port du module haptique sous le bouton marche arrêt Puis branche la partie USB sur un port USB de ton ordinateur Important Tenter d utiliser un câble USB C à USB C ou un adaptateur à prise mural à la place d ...

Page 21: ...nnecté à un autre appareil PC téléphone Oculus Quest La LED de batterie devrait clignoter 1 Ouvre les paramètres Windows 2 Clique sur Périphérique 3 Clique sur Appareils Bluetooth et autres 4 Allume le Bluetooth si cela n est pas déjà fait 5 Clique sur Ajouter un appareil Bluetooth ou un autre appareil 6 Clique sur Bluetooth 7 Comme mentionné ci dessus tous les modules haptiques sont appelés Force...

Page 22: ...utre port USB Windows peut avoir des difficultés pensant que c est une nouvelle clé Bluetooth même si ce n est pas le cas Dans ce cas tu devrais enlever le module haptique de tes appareils appairés en Bluetooth et le réappairer Si tu ne sais pas comment faire voici comment 1 Va dans le Gestionnaire de périphériques 2 Clique sur Affichage 3 Clique sur Afficher les périphériques cachés 4 Développe l...

Page 23: ...Si le problème vient de ton ordinateur la première chose à vérifier est la clef Bluetooth Si tu utilises une clef que tu possédais déjà essaie de la désinstaller et d utiliser celle que nous te fournissons Si tu utilises la clef que nous fournissons désinstalle la redémarre ton ordinateur et réinstalle la sur un autre port USB à l avant de l ordinateur si possible o Si après avoir essayé sur diffé...

Page 24: ...amVR Va dans ta Bibliothèque SteamVR Clic droit sur Onward Choisi propriétés Dans l onglet Général clique sur Définir les options de lancement Ecris forcetube sans les Redémarre le jeu s il était lancé L option FORCETUBEVR doit être mise sur ENABLED ACTIVE dans le menu setting paramètres o Sur Oculus Quest 1 2 Suis l étape 3 2 Une fois fait va dans les paramètres du jeu Onward Puis dans les paramè...

Page 25: ...ProTubeVR VR Gaming Accessories 2021 01 20 Documentation équipement Haptique Page 25 on 34 ...

Page 26: ...roTubeVR ForceTubeVR User Content 2 Sélectionne ForceTubeVR Companion 3 Sélectionne ForceTubeVR Companion Application rar 4 Et Sélectionne Download pour télécharger le fichier rar Pour mettre à jour le fichier dll 1 Va dans les fichiers locaux du jeu 2 Trouve le fichier ForceTube dll Il s appelle ForceTubeVR_API_x32 dll ou ForceTubeVR_API_x64 dll 3 Ajoute old au nom du fichier existant 4 Copie le ...

Page 27: ...urs qui ont plusieurs modules haptiques sont cachés si Show advanced settings est désactivé Dans ce cas tous les paramètres visibles et les périphériques que tu peux activer dans l onglet Demo ciblent tous les canaux haptiques de façon indifférente Si Show advanced settings est activé l onglet Channels binding l onglet Knuckles fix et la liste déroulante Targeted channel sont visibles Et tous les ...

Page 28: ...nnel afin de correspondre à la colonne que tu as sélectionnée Tu peux aussi voir le bouton Save channels order en bas de cet onglet Il sauvegarde les modules haptiques qui ont été forcés dans le canal Si tu quittes et redémarres l application cela sera gardé comme tu l as sauvegardé 5 2 RETROCOMPATIBILITE POUR STEAMVR Tu peux l utiliser pour réutiliser les requêtes de vibration envoyées par SteamV...

Page 29: ...e même problème qui arrive aux moteurs de vibrations car ils font des mouvements circulaires et non pas des allers retours Dans ce cas il te suffit de réduire la puissance du kick car directement lié à la durée d activation des moteurs de vibration et à la durée d activation du moteur Le curseur Minimum rumble duration te permet de choisir la durée minimum de vibration générée par le module haptiq...

Page 30: ...bilité haptique dans la section 4 1 Souviens toi que si tu changes quelque chose ici Tu ne le fais que pour le canal sélectionné Tu peux voir laquelle est sélectionnée dans la liste déroulante Targeted Channel Pour choisir laquelle tu veux modifier sélectionne la dans la liste déroulante Le curseur Native kick power multiplier te permet d augmenter ou de réduire la puissance du kick de la requête ...

Page 31: ...M16 envoie une rafale de trois petits coups L interrupteur Example PKM envoie des tirs puissants moins fréquents tant qu il est activé Le bouton Example lasergun active une vibration grandissante simulant un canon laser qui charge lorsqu on appuie la première fois et envoie un puissant tir avec une puissance de vibration relative à la durée de charge lorsqu on appuie la seconde fois Le bouton Cust...

Page 32: ...riger ce défaut Tu peux le trouver dans le fichier Valve Index Knuckles driver directement dans le répertoire de la Companion Application Ouvre le ferme SteamVR et exécute InstallDriver exe L onglet Knuckle fix dans ta Companion Application est maintenant fonctionnel Une fois fait le bouton Enable knuckles to fix te permet d activer et de désactiver les rectifications suivantes Lorsqu il est activ...

Page 33: ...en cliquant dessus et en sélectionnant le canal que tu souhaites éditer ou cibler Lorsque tu choisis un nouveau canal tu devrais voir les valeurs de SteamVR Backward Compatibility et Native Game Personalization changer du canal sélectionné 6 3 AFFICHER LE RENDU DU PERIPHERIQUE Le bouton Display ProTubeVR renderer ouvre une fenêtre transparente contenant une image de module haptique L arrière du mo...

Page 34: ...la même que celle déjà présente dans le ForceTube l application le signale et refuse la mise à jour o Si le ForceTube n arrive pas à se connecter au réseau wifi pendant 10 secondes il renvoie un signal à l application pour retenter une connexion Si le périphérique arrive à se connecter au réseau wifi une fenêtre qui renvoie sur un formulaire de téléchargement s ouvre dans le navigateur Choisir le ...

Reviews: